Quarterly Planning Note — Insurance Renewal

Team, our property and liability cover through Ashgrove Mutual comes up for renewal at quarter-end, and early quotes are running about 12% higher thanks to the Delverton warehouse claim last spring. We're shopping two alternative carriers, but don't bank on savings — budget for the increase. Heads of department, please confirm your asset registers are current by the planning deadline so we're not underinsured again. How this ties into next year's direction is noted below.

internal memo for kaduf-baduf: Only 35 of the 378 pilot accounts renewed Holir, so a churn review is set for June 11. Eliielax Group is in early talks to buy Silaelix Group for about $142.1 million.

# Break-Glass: Catalog Cache Invalidation

Scope: the Pinrow product catalog at Veldstone Retail. If stale prices persist after a purge and the Hollowmere invalidation queue is wedged, use break-glass to flush the edge tier directly. Contractors: get verbal sign-off from the catalog lead first. Steps: open the Hollowmere admin shell, select emergency-flush, confirm the tenant, and run it once — repeated flushes thrash the origin. Access is logged and expires after 20 minutes. Unseal the admin shell with the passphrase below.

recovery phrase for kahop-tajog: istix-casvan

Ticket #4417 — Locked Dependency Vault

The Larkspur build vault locked itself after three failed attestation checks during the pin-refresh job. Per our dependency pinning policy, no unpinned packages may ship, so the 3.2 release is blocked until the vault reopens. Please review the pin manifest diff once access is restored. Use the recovery phrase below to unseal it.

strongbox words: zorwyn-sorael-belion-ulaius-silmir-ulays-briax-rusdor-gorix

## Handover: Gleamtrace GPU profiler

Hey — taking over Gleamtrace from me, here's the short version for the plugin side. The sampler hooks allocation events and streams them to the collector; your plugins subscribe to that feed, they don't touch driver memory directly. Don't hold references past the flush callback or you'll skew the numbers. The capture ring is small on purpose, so batch your reads. Tests live next to the sample plugin. The collector expects the settings listed below when your plugin registers.

service settings:
HOLDOR_PIN=6477
HOLDOR_METRICS_HOST=metrics.holdor.nelvrocorp.corp
HOLDOR_LOG_LEVEL=error
HOLDOR_TENANT=noviel